A nursing research paper is a work of academic writing composed by a nurse or nursing student. The paper may present information on a specific topic or answer a question.

During LPN/LVN and RN programs, most papers you write focus on learning to use research databases, evaluate appropriate resources, and format your writing with APA style. You'll then synthesize your research information to answer a question or analyze a topic.

BSN , MSN , Ph.D., and DNP programs also write nursing research papers. Students in these programs may also participate in conducting original research studies.

Writing papers during your academic program improves and develops many skills, including the ability to:

  • Select nursing topics for research
  • Conduct effective research
  • Analyze published academic literature
  • Format and cite sources
  • Synthesize data
  • Organize and articulate findings

About Nursing Research Papers

When do nursing students write research papers.

You may need to write a research paper for any of the nursing courses you take. Research papers help develop critical thinking and communication skills. They allow you to learn how to conduct research and critically review publications.

That said, not every class will require in-depth, 10-20-page papers. The more advanced your degree path, the more you can expect to write and conduct research. If you're in an associate or bachelor's program, you'll probably write a few papers each semester or term.

Do Nursing Students Conduct Original Research?

Most of the time, you won't be designing, conducting, and evaluating new research. Instead, your projects will focus on learning the research process and the scientific method. You'll achieve these objectives by evaluating existing nursing literature and sources and defending a thesis.

However, many nursing faculty members do conduct original research. So, you may get opportunities to participate in, and publish, research articles.

Example Research Project Scenario:

In your maternal child nursing class, the professor assigns the class a research paper regarding developmentally appropriate nursing interventions for the pediatric population. While that may sound specific, you have almost endless opportunities to narrow down the focus of your writing. 

You could choose pain intervention measures in toddlers. Conversely, you can research the effects of prolonged hospitalization on adolescents' social-emotional development.

What Does a Nursing Research Paper Include?

Your professor should provide a thorough guideline of the scope of the paper. In general, an undergraduate nursing research paper will consist of:

Introduction : A brief overview of the research question/thesis statement your paper will discuss. You can include why the topic is relevant.

Body : This section presents your research findings and allows you to synthesize the information and data you collected. You'll have a chance to articulate your evaluation and answer your research question. The length of this section depends on your assignment.

Conclusion : A brief review of the information and analysis you presented throughout the body of the paper. This section is a recap of your paper and another chance to reassert your thesis.

The best advice is to follow your instructor's rubric and guidelines. Remember to ask for help whenever needed, and avoid overcomplicating the assignment!

How to Choose a Nursing Research Topic

The sheer volume of prospective nursing research topics can become overwhelming for students. Additionally, you may get the misconception that all the 'good' research ideas are exhausted. However, a personal approach may help you narrow down a research topic and find a unique angle.

Writing your research paper about a topic you value or connect with makes the task easier. Additionally, you should consider the material's breadth. Topics with plenty of existing literature will make developing a research question and thesis smoother.

Finally, feel free to shift gears if necessary, especially if you're still early in the research process. If you start down one path and have trouble finding published information, ask your professor if you can choose another topic.

Tips for Writing a Nursing Research Paper

The best nursing research advice we can provide is to follow your professor's rubric and instructions. However, here are a few study tips for nursing students to make paper writing less painful:

Avoid procrastination: Everyone says it, but few follow this advice. You can significantly lower your stress levels if you avoid procrastinating and start working on your project immediately.

Plan Ahead: Break down the writing process into smaller sections, especially if it seems overwhelming. Give yourself time for each step in the process.

Research: Use your resources and ask for help from the librarian or instructor. The rest should come together quickly once you find high-quality studies to analyze.

Outline: Create an outline to help you organize your thoughts. Then, you can plug in information throughout the research process. 

Clear Language: Use plain language as much as possible to get your point across. Jargon is inevitable when writing academic nursing papers, but keep it to a minimum.

Cite Properly: Accurately cite all sources using the appropriate citation style. Nursing research papers will almost always implement APA style. Check out the resources below for some excellent reference management options.

Revise and Edit: Once you finish your first draft, put it away for one to two hours or, preferably, a whole day. Once you've placed some space between you and your paper, read through and edit for clarity, coherence, and grammatical errors. Reading your essay out loud is an excellent way to check for the 'flow' of the paper.

Helpful Nursing Research Writing Resources:

Purdue OWL (Online writing lab) has a robust APA guide covering everything you need about APA style and rules.

Grammarly helps you edit grammar, spelling, and punctuation. Upgrading to a paid plan will get you plagiarism detection, formatting, and engagement suggestions. This tool is excellent to help you simplify complicated sentences.

Mendeley is a free reference management software. It stores, organizes, and cites references. It has a Microsoft plug-in that inserts and correctly formats APA citations.

Evidence-based practice nursing involves integrating the use of the best available evidence into the care of patients. The subject is not new and has been around for several decades. It is now becoming a career option for many healthcare professionals. Evidence-based practice nursing improves patient outcomes, reduces costs, and enhances a hospital’s reputation.

Evidence-based practice nursing incorporates four fundamental principles:

The use of the best available evidence to make decisions about care for patients with specific health problems;

  • The ability to recognise gaps in knowledge about how to provide safe and effective patient care;
  • The ability to identify potential barriers that may interfere with implementing evidence-based practices; and
  • The ability to translate research findings into clinical practice guidelines and other practical resources

Background 

Few quantitative studies have documented the types of research topics most commonly employed by nursing PhD students and whether they differ by program delivery (in-person vs. online/hybrid programs).

Objectives 

We examined a large set of publicly available PhD dissertation abstracts to (a) describe the relative prevalence of different research topics and methods and (b) test whether the primary topics and methods used differed between online or hybrid and in-person PhD programs. A secondary goal was to introduce the reader to modern text-mining approaches to generate insights from a document corpus.

Methods 

Our database consisted of 2,027 dissertation abstracts published between 2015 and 2019. We used a structural topic modeling text-mining approach to explore PhD students’ research topics and methods in United States-based doctoral nursing programs.

Results 

We identified 24 different research topics representing a wide range of research activities. Most of the research topics identified did not differ in prevalence between online/hybrid and in-person programs. However, online/hybrid programs were more likely to engage students in research focused on nursing education, professional development, work environment, simulation, and qualitative analysis. Pediatrics, sleep science, older adults and aging, and chronic disease management were more prevalent topics in in-person-only programs.

Discussion 

The range of topics identified highlights the breadth of research nursing PhD students’ conduct. Both in-person and online/hybrid programs offer a range of research opportunities, although we did observe some differences in topic prevalence. These differences could be due to the nature of some types of research (e.g., research that requires an in-person presence) or differences in research intensity between programs (e.g., amount of grant funding or proximity to a medical center). Future research should explore why research topic prevalence may vary by program delivery. We hope that this text-mining application serves as an illustrative example for researchers considering how to draw inferences from large sets of text documents. We are particularly interested in seeing future work that might combine traditional qualitative approaches and large-scale text mining to leverage the advantages of each.

What's the best way to research and write your undergraduate dissertation? ARU nursing student Jade shares her top ten tips.

From the end of your second year, your personal tutors and lecturers will start to discuss the big one – your Undergraduate Major Project, otherwise known as your dissertation.

Having just completed mine I feel I have picked up information along the way that is still fresh that I can pass on to help you with yours. Here are ten tips to help you prepare and write your dissertation.

1. Start thinking about your dissertation topic early on

I study Adult Nursing and in my case, there is a list of around 30 or so overarching topics that your topic must come under. However, these are very broad and almost any topic of interest related to nursing can be allocated under one of these headings.

It is really important to talk about a subject that you have a lot of interest in. Your dissertation is going to take you the best part of your third year to complete, and you need to have a vested interest in the subject to be able to cope with the amount of research, reading and writing you will do. Try and think back through your training to things you are passionate about, things that have held your interest or things you want to know more about. This will help narrow your focus and make the time spent easier to deal with.

2. Start your research early

...preferably at the end of Year 2 when you have a break in between assignments and starting third year. To some this may seem very early but I can promise you it is worth it. The last thing you want is to be starting your dissertation and then finding that your topic has little to no primary research on the subject, making it very difficult to write a literature review.

When third year starts there's a lot expected from you in placement , so having some research started will save you hours and hours of crucial time, and help you to understand your topic and focus on what to write using the research available.

3. Scan your notes from your research module

Your dissertation is a literature review and it will help for you to brush up on your research studies as you will be critically analysing pieces of primary research throughout your assignment. I would also advise you to take out a couple of books from the library to do with types of research. I'm not saying you need to read the whole book but I used a couple and it made looking up research types, their advantages and disadvantages and criticism of the work a lot easier.

4. Use the University Library research database

Please make sure that you listen to the lectures from the librarians on how to use the research databases properly and effectively. It is very easy to say but you would be surprised how many students – after having this lecture every year – still return to the University Library  and ask for extra teaching on this because they did not pay attention.

You'll need to search properly for research and write a section on how you did this in your dissertation. Not only will this give you marks but you do not want to miss out on important pieces of research because you could not use the databases to the best of your ability. Half of your workload and hours for this project will be finding and reading relevant and appropriate literature on your topic.

5. Make proper use of your dissertation supervisor

Many students make the mistake of leaving contact with their supervisor very late or even not at all. Your supervisor is there to help guide you through your assignment and is the most useful tool you have in writing your dissertation. Make early contact once you know who they are, discuss your topic ideas and keep in regular contact via meetings and email after this. You can tell the difference between the work of those students who have worked with their supervisors and those who haven't.

If you have a particular topic in mind before the allocation of supervisors, you can even contact the allocator to ask for somebody who has an interest in your topic. I knew I wanted mine to be cardiac based and I requested the cardiac lecturer for my supervisor and was granted this, which was invaluable to me.

6. Use helpful resources

Use the module guide, lecture slides and the Cluedo board on ARU's virtual learning environment for guidance on structure and writing your assignment.

All of these tools will have information on the exact order in which things should be presented, the format down to margins and font sizes and will give examples of good pieces of writing in each section. I looked at these early on and made notes on each part, giving me a sound structure to follow and helping me get in the mindset for writing my work.

7. Make a plan before you start writing

Make sure you have a plan and a good solid idea of your themes before starting writing your dissertation.

Your themes take up the main part of your assignment and are what the rest of your review and the title will reflect and discuss. Your themes will come best from looking at your research and seeing what is common there. It is much easier to build your themes around what you have found than to make a theme and try and force your research to fit. This will be obvious and not flow very well reducing your marks considerably.

8. Take regular breaks when writing

It is important not to give your dissertation half an hour's attention here and there as this will break the flow of writing. However, do allow yourself time to relax and enjoy things outside of placement and assignments as this will keep your head relaxed and clearer when studying.

9. Back up your work

Send it to your student email, personal email, save it on your personal computer, the University computer and a memory stick. Regularly update them with your current work. I watched several students in my cohort lose sections of their work and have to start again as they could not find them. This is unnecessary stress for sure and a devastating thing to happen. Avoid this at all costs!

10. Celebrate when you finish your dissertation

Finally, make sure you celebrate and treat yourself once it is over and you've handed your dissertation in. This, for most, will be one of the biggest pieces of academic work and achievement in their life so far and should be celebrated. Buy yourself something nice, treat yourself to dinner, celebrate with friends. Mark the occasion in any way as this will give you something to look forward to once it is complete and will feel wonderful.

Example public health service dissertation topic 1:

Mentoring in the NHS: A case study based analysis

New entrants into the profession whether at nursing or clinical level are traditionally mentored by established colleagues. This is not only done so as to ensure that best practice is followed but also to introduce them into the culture of the organisation and the institution in question. Using accepted NHS mentoring protocols as the literature framework for this study this dissertation charts the experiences of five students at three hospitals within the south-west of England. It records their initial expectations of mentoring their experiences during the mentoring processes and their evaluation of the process thereafter. Through this study a number of recommendations to improve the quality of mentoring is suggested.

Suggested initial topic reading:

  • Holbeche, L. (1996), ‘Peer mentoring: the challenges and opportunities’, Career Development International , Vol. 1 (7), pp.24 – 27
  • Stead, V. (2005), ‘Mentoring: a model for leadership development?’, International Journal of Training and Development , Vol. 9, pp. 170-184.

Example public health service dissertation topic 2:

Co-operative working strategies between registered nurses and care assistants: An observational study

Registered nurses have strict obligations under the code of conduct of the Nursing and Midwifery Council. Health care assistants are not regulated; thus issues can arise between the two groups when working together as each may not understand the imperatives that drive them. This study examines some of the problems that both registered nurses and care assistants experience – from both sides of the equation – and considers ways that co-operative working may be better achieved. It examines practices that are already existing and interviews a range of nurses and care assistants to make recommendations of coping mechanisms.

Example palliative care dissertation topic 1:

Spiritual awareness within nursing skills: A study in palliative care

Palliative care can be defined as the active holistic care of patients with advanced progressive illness. Accordingly, the management of pain and other symptoms and provision of psychological, social and spiritual support is paramount to best practice within palliative care. The goal of palliative care is the achievement of the best quality of life for patients and their families in the little time remaining that they have. Using a range of research stratagems – but primarily interviews with the dying and their relatives – this dissertation gets to the heart of what patients and their loved ones would like from the professionals who look after them. By tackling this sensitive area and doing so in this manner this dissertation is uniquely placed to offer not only insight but recommendations to further support the needs of loved ones and those that they leave behind.

Example nurse well-being dissertation topic 1:

The incidence of ‘burn-out’ in psychiatric nursing

This dissertation has two principal aims. First, it evaluates factors within the work environment that may be seen to directly contribute to the occurrence of burn-out. Secondly, it examines the extent to which the rate of burn-out is lower in public health nurses engaged in general nursing services compared to the level within community psychiatric nursing. This dissertation adopts a case study approach to these questions and accordingly interviews ten of each type of nurses. Thereafter Pines’ burn-out scale was used to classify the results obtained and the data transferred to graphs. This subsequently enables a number of recommendations to be proffered as well as the suggestion that further study into the prevalence of burn-out should be undertaken using a larger sample number.

Example treatment and pain management dissertation topic 1:

Treating feet wounds in diabetic cases: Best practice nursing techniques

As a multisystem disorder, diabetes affects the process by which wounds heal.

Healing may be delayed as a consequence of psychological changes in tissues and consequently, it is imperative that nursing professionals are aware of the best practice by which to manage and treat diabetic wounds. Building on the work of existing research this dissertation offers a practice based review of treatment being offered at a teaching hospital in the north-west of England and evaluates the extent to which it confirms to best practice guidelines. Given the breadth of research on diabetes this dissertation focuses particularly on the problems of wounds to feet and legs. This is, accordingly, a dissertation that has the potential to make a number of key recommendations to ensure that patient care is always maximised.
